Considering the lack of a unified framework for image description and deep cultural analysis at the subject level in the field of Ancient Chinese Paintings (ACP), this study utilized the Beijing Palace Museum's ACP collections to develop a semantic model integrating the iconological theory with a new workflow for term extraction and mapping. Our findings underscore the model's effectiveness. SDM can be used to support further art-related knowledge organization and cultural exploration of ACPs.
